The best gooseneck kettle for pour-over coffee comes down to one thing: flow control. A restricted spout is typically designed to cap flow somewhere in the 15–40 ml/sec range — narrow enough that you can slow to a thin, steady stream during bloom instead of flooding the bed. Most straight-spout kettles pour far faster than that, which is why they’re hard to use for anything beyond filling a mug.

Why pour control gets you specialty coffee results, not just “better vibes”

Beginners often start with a basic kettle, then wonder why their pour-over tastes inconsistent cup to cup. Most of that inconsistency comes from how the water actually moves inside the dripper — not from the ritual around it.

With a true gooseneck, two physical design choices matter most for pour control: the spout diameter/shape and the way the neck guides the stream into the coffee bed. Together they influence flow-rate precision, your ability to repeat a bloom, and how evenly you can run a controlled spiral through the grounds. The Specialty Coffee Association’s brewing research treats even water distribution as core to extraction, not a garnish on top of it.

  • Spout diameter and shape change how easily you can “feather” the pour when your target is low flow.
  • Flow restriction helps prevent channeling, because the stream is less likely to carve a single path through the bed.
  • Handle balance controls wrist fatigue, which directly affects how steady your pour feels after a few slow spirals.
  • Electric heat hold (if you go that route) helps maintain temperature targets during the time between heating, pouring, and extraction.

Your kettle is the “output driver” for water delivery. If that output is unstable, your extraction becomes a guessing game — and no amount of dial-in fixes that.

What to look for in a gooseneck kettle for pour-over coffee (spouts, temps, capacity)

If we had to boil it down, we’d ask one question: does this kettle make the next pour repeatable? In 2026, the best gooseneck kettle for pour-over coffee is usually the one that lets you stay consistent across three variables — flow, temperature, and ergonomics.

1) Spout diameter and shape, where pour control actually starts

A gooseneck spout isn’t just a “look.” It changes the stream dynamics, and stream dynamics are what let you slow down during bloom, then speed up slightly during the main drawdown without overshooting.

  • Narrower openings generally make low-flow control easier.
  • Longer necks help aim the stream so you can work a steady spiral without splashing.
  • Stream stability matters, because micro-drips create minor bed agitation differences that can shift extraction.

2) Temperature hold stability (PID vs variable-temp electric vs stovetop)

Even if you nail your brew ratio and use the same coffee grinders, temperature can drift where it matters. Water commonly loses several degrees between the kettle and the coffee slurry — often somewhere in the 5–15°C range depending on pour speed, cup material, and room temperature — so “near boiling” isn’t the same as hitting your actual brewing target.

  • PID-controlled electric kettles hold tighter temperature ranges for stable extraction.
  • Variable-temp electric kettles are good, but check how long they maintain the set point.
  • Stovetop kettles are simple and reliable, but they require timing discipline.

3) Capacity vs counter footprint (your coffee station layout)

Capacity matters if you brew multiple cups back to back, but counter footprint matters if your setup is a tight home coffee corner. The Fellow Stagg EKG’s base, for example, is roughly six inches across — compact enough to fit a prosumer workflow without turning your counter into a cluttered control panel.

4) Handle balance and wrist fatigue during slow pours

Slow pour-over technique demands stable wrist angles. If the handle is poorly balanced, you’ll compensate mid-pour, and your spiral becomes uneven — especially during the 2-3 pours most recipes use for bloom and continuation.

5) Flow restrictor designs worth knowing about

Some kettles effectively “teach” you slower pours. The effect can come from spout geometry alone, from valve behavior in electric models, or from how the neck guides the stream so flow naturally caps when you tilt less.

That’s why restricted-flow gooseneck designs are worth the small price premium for pour-over, especially if you’re stepping up from a basic drip setup with consistent specialty coffee goals.

How kettle choice connects to real pour-over technique (bloom, spiral pours, extraction)

Here’s the connection most people miss: kettle design affects what you can do during bloom agitation and controlled spiral pours, and those steps drive extraction outcomes.

Bloom agitation: use controlled flow, not force

During bloom, you’re trying to evenly wet grounds and release trapped CO2, not flood the bed. A restricted gooseneck flow makes it easier to maintain a low, steady stream while you build volume gradually.

  • Slow flow helps the bed expand evenly, reducing uneven wetting.
  • Stable aiming lets you bloom across the whole surface rather than drilling a channel.

Controlled spiral pours: keep your wrist repeatable

The spiral technique is basically a repeatable input pattern. If your kettle’s spout is hard to feather, your spiral becomes a series of inconsistent jets, which changes bed agitation and extraction rate.

  • Balance in the handle helps you keep the same arc and height across pours.
  • Stream stability helps you land water consistently without splashing and channeling.

Match kettle stability to your brew workflow

Hold times vary a lot by design. Some premium electric kettles keep water close to your set point for up to an hour, while more basic electric models can drift off target within 20–30 minutes. If your routine is unhurried, that gap barely matters. If you’re pouring for guests back-to-back, it’s the difference between a consistent bloom and a lukewarm one.

What makes a gooseneck kettle better for pour-over coffee than a regular kettle?

A gooseneck kettle improves pour-over control because the spout diameter and shape limit and direct the flow more precisely. That helps you manage bloom agitation and controlled spiral pours without channeling, which directly affects extraction quality in pour-over coffee.

Is an electric gooseneck kettle worth it in 2026 for specialty coffee brewing?

In 2026, an electric gooseneck kettle is worth it when you want temperature hold stability that supports repeatable extraction. PID or variable-temp electric models can be especially helpful if you brew daily and need consistent temperature during the time between heating and pouring.

How slow should a gooseneck kettle pour for best results?

Many restricted-flow gooseneck kettles target low flow behavior, roughly 15–40 ml/sec, which makes it easier to feather the pour during bloom and main pours. The goal is controlled volume delivery, not speed, so you can keep the coffee bed evenly wetted.

Does kettle temperature accuracy matter if I already use a good coffee grinder and scale?

Yes. Even with a great grinder and an accurate scale, the temperature drop from kettle to slurry can be significant, often in the 5–15°C range. Stable kettle temperatures help you stay on target so extraction doesn’t drift.
